Step 1: Initial Consultation
The journey begins with a detailed consultation. During the session of Hair Transplant in Dubai, a hair transplant specialist evaluates your hair loss, scalp condition, and medical history to determine the most suitable treatment option. The two primary techniques available are:
- FUE (Follicular Unit Extraction): Involves extracting individual hair follicles and implanting them in balding areas.
- FUT (Follicular Unit Transplantation): Involves removing a strip of scalp from the donor area and transplanting the follicles.
Your surgeon will recommend the best approach based on your hair loss pattern and desired results.

Step 3: The Hair Transplant Procedure
On the day of the Hair Transplant in Dubai, you will undergo the following steps:
- Local Anesthesia: Ensures a pain-free experience.
- Hair Follicle Extraction:
- In FUE, follicles are extracted individually.
- In FUT, a strip of scalp is removed, and follicles are extracted from it.
- Graft Preparation: The extracted follicles are sorted and prepared for implantation.
- Implantation: The surgeon meticulously implants the follicles in the bald areas.
- Completion & Dressing: The treated area is covered with a bandage, and post-care instructions are provided.
The entire procedure can take 4-8 hours, depending on the number of grafts.

Step 4: Immediate Post-Surgery Recovery
Right after the surgery, you may experience:
- Minor swelling and redness.
- Scabbing in the treated area.
- Slight discomfort that can be managed with prescribed pain relievers.
Doctors recommend sleeping with an elevated head position to reduce swelling and avoiding strenuous activities for a few days.
Step 5: First Two Weeks (Healing Phase)
- Days 1-3: Mild swelling and scabbing are common.
- Days 4-7: Scabs begin to fall off naturally.
- Days 7-14: New hair follicles settle into the scalp.
It is crucial to follow proper scalp hygiene and avoid direct sun exposure during this period.
Step 6: First Month (Shedding Phase)
- The “shock loss” phase occurs, where transplanted hair falls out. This is normal and temporary.
- Hair follicles remain intact, and new hair growth will begin in the coming months.
- Regular check-ups with your surgeon are recommended to monitor progress.
Step 7: Three to Six Months (Regrowth Begins)
- New hair starts emerging, though it may initially appear fine and thin.
- Growth improves gradually as the hair thickens.
- A healthy diet and scalp care routine can enhance the regrowth process.
Step 8: Six to Twelve Months (Full Hair Growth)
- By six months, noticeable hair density improvement is observed.
- By twelve months, the final results become visible, with natural-looking hair growth.
- Regular haircuts and styling can now be done.
